Temple Made: Neiman wins ‘Best of Show’ for crowdsourced branding campaign

Center City marketing agency Neiman came away with nine awards at the Higher Education Marketing Awards, including “Best of Show,” for its crowdsourced “Temple Made” campaign, according to a Neiman release. Neiman beat out more than 3,000 entries.

The campaign for Temple University encouraged students, faculty, staff and alumni to tweet and Instagram using the hashtag #TempleMade and then aggregated the contributions to show the school through community members’ eyes.

Two other Philly universities won “Best of Show” at the Higher Education Marketing Awards: St. Joseph’s University and Philadelphia University, though neither of the marketing agencies that did those campaigns were local. Find the list of “Best of Show” winners here.
